Abstract
We study the spontaneous phase separation of a binary mixture in the p resence of a flat wall, focusing on the early stage of the demixing ki netics. Based on a Ginzburg-Landau type approach, we show the existenc e of novel unstable concentration waves with wave vectors (k) over rig ht arrow(parallel to) parallel to the wall, which are characterized by a surface dispersion relation omega(s)(k(parallel to)) and amplitudes (s) over bar decaying exponentially into the bulk. The surface modes are superimposed on the laterally averaged concentration profile and a re directly observable by experiment, if the wall right after a quench does not favor any of the two components of the mixture.
